Parallel Execution in Smart Contracts_ Pioneering the Path to Scalability for 100k TPS

Dashiell Hammett
5 min read
Add Yahoo on Google
Parallel Execution in Smart Contracts_ Pioneering the Path to Scalability for 100k TPS
Unveiling the ZK Proof P2P Powerhouse_ Revolutionizing Decentralized Networks
(ST PHOTO: GIN TAY)
Goosahiuqwbekjsahdbqjkweasw

Parallel Execution in Smart Contracts: Pioneering the Path to Scalability for 100k TPS

In the rapidly evolving landscape of blockchain technology, scalability remains one of the most critical challenges. The vision of achieving 100k transactions per second (TPS) in decentralized networks has become a focal point for innovation and technological advancement. At the heart of this transformative journey is the concept of parallel execution in smart contracts, a powerful mechanism that promises to unlock unprecedented scalability and efficiency.

The Current Landscape of Blockchain Scalability

Today’s blockchain networks, while revolutionary, often struggle with throughput limitations. Traditional blockchain architectures typically process a few thousand transactions per second. This constraint has spurred a global quest for solutions that can exponentially increase transaction throughput, making blockchain as scalable as centralized systems.

The Promise of Parallel Execution

Parallel execution represents a significant leap forward in addressing these scalability concerns. By enabling multiple smart contracts to execute simultaneously on the same blockchain, this approach drastically increases the network's capacity to handle transactions. Imagine a world where the blockchain can process 100,000 transactions per second, effectively rivaling the speed of traditional financial systems.

Understanding Smart Contracts

Smart contracts are self-executing contracts with the terms directly written into code. They automate the execution of agreements, reducing the need for intermediaries and ensuring transparency and trust. However, when a blockchain network is inundated with numerous transactions, the sequential nature of execution can bottleneck performance.

The Role of Parallel Execution

Parallel execution changes the game by allowing multiple smart contracts to run concurrently. This means that instead of waiting for one transaction to complete before moving on to the next, the blockchain can process several at the same time. This is akin to having multiple chefs in a kitchen, each preparing a dish simultaneously, thereby expediting the overall cooking process.

Technical Mechanisms Behind Parallel Execution

At its core, parallel execution leverages advanced computational algorithms and distributed ledger technologies. Blockchain nodes are configured to process transactions in parallel, effectively dividing the workload among them. This approach reduces bottlenecks, lowers latency, and significantly enhances throughput.

Ethereum’s Vision for Scalability

Ethereum, the leading blockchain platform for smart contracts, has been at the forefront of this scalability revolution. With Ethereum 2.0, the network aims to introduce sharding and parallel execution to achieve 100k TPS. Sharding divides the blockchain into smaller, manageable pieces called shards, each capable of processing transactions in parallel. This fragmentation enhances the overall scalability and efficiency of the network.

Real-World Implications

The implications of achieving 100k TPS through parallel execution are profound. Decentralized applications (dApps) and platforms that rely on smart contracts can now handle a massive volume of transactions without experiencing downtime or performance degradation. This scalability opens new avenues for innovation, enabling complex, high-demand applications such as decentralized finance (DeFi), supply chain management, and more.

Challenges and Considerations

While the promise of parallel execution is tantalizing, several challenges remain. Ensuring the security and integrity of parallel transactions is paramount. Synchronization across nodes, managing the load balance, and preventing bottlenecks are critical issues that developers and engineers must address. Moreover, the transition to parallel execution requires a robust upgrade path and seamless integration with existing smart contract frameworks.

Future Prospects

Looking ahead, the future of parallel execution in smart contracts is brimming with potential. As blockchain technology continues to mature, we can anticipate further advancements that will push the boundaries of scalability even further. Innovations in consensus algorithms, network architecture, and computational efficiency will play pivotal roles in this journey.

Conclusion

Parallel execution in smart contracts is a game-changer in the quest for blockchain scalability. By enabling multiple transactions to be processed simultaneously, this approach holds the key to unlocking the true potential of decentralized networks. As we stand on the brink of a new era in blockchain technology, the vision of achieving 100k TPS through parallel execution is not just a possibility—it's an imminent reality.

Parallel Execution in Smart Contracts: Pioneering the Path to Scalability for 100k TPS

Building on the foundational concepts of parallel execution and its transformative potential, this second part delves deeper into the nuances of this revolutionary technology. We will explore its technical underpinnings, real-world applications, and the future trajectory of scalability in blockchain networks.

Advanced Computational Techniques

The crux of parallel execution lies in its sophisticated computational techniques. These techniques involve breaking down complex transactions into smaller, manageable units that can be processed in parallel. This division of tasks is akin to the way multi-core processors handle tasks in the world of traditional computing. Advanced algorithms are employed to ensure that these parallel processes are synchronized and coordinated efficiently across the network.

Consensus Mechanisms and Parallel Execution

Consensus mechanisms play a crucial role in ensuring the integrity and security of parallel transactions. While proof-of-work (PoW) and proof-of-stake (PoS) are the most common consensus mechanisms, they need to be adapted to support parallel execution. For instance, PoS-based systems like Ethereum 2.0 utilize a combination of sharding and consensus algorithms to manage parallel transactions securely and effectively.

Sharding and Its Role

Sharding is a pivotal technique in the architecture of parallel execution. By dividing the blockchain into smaller, more manageable pieces known as shards, each capable of processing a portion of the network’s transactions, sharding enhances scalability. Within each shard, parallel execution can take place, allowing for a significant increase in throughput. This distributed approach mitigates bottlenecks and ensures that the network can handle a higher volume of transactions.

Interoperability and Cross-Shard Communication

One of the critical challenges in sharding is ensuring interoperability and seamless communication between shards. Transactions that span multiple shards need efficient cross-shard communication protocols. Advanced cryptographic techniques and consensus algorithms are employed to facilitate these interactions securely. This interoperability is essential for the smooth operation of decentralized applications that rely on data and transactions across different shards.

Real-World Applications and Use Cases

The real-world applications of parallel execution in smart contracts are vast and varied. In decentralized finance (DeFi), for instance, parallel execution enables platforms to process numerous transactions simultaneously, supporting complex financial instruments like lending, borrowing, and trading. Supply chain management systems benefit from parallel execution by handling multiple transactions related to product tracking, inventory management, and compliance verification.

Decentralized Autonomous Organizations (DAOs)

Decentralized Autonomous Organizations (DAOs) are another prime example where parallel execution shines. DAOs rely on smart contracts to manage governance, funding, and operational tasks. By leveraging parallel execution, DAOs can process a multitude of governance votes, funding requests, and operational tasks simultaneously, ensuring efficient and transparent management.

Gaming and NFTs

The gaming industry and the burgeoning world of non-fungible tokens (NFTs) also stand to gain immensely from parallel execution. Games with complex economies and NFT marketplaces can handle a massive number of transactions related to asset ownership, trading, and in-game activities. Parallel execution ensures that these transactions are processed swiftly, maintaining the seamless experience for users.

Security and Risk Management

While the benefits of parallel execution are substantial, security and risk management remain top priorities. Ensuring the integrity and security of parallel transactions involves robust cryptographic techniques, consensus algorithms, and continuous monitoring. Developers and engineers must address potential vulnerabilities such as 51% attacks, smart contract exploits, and cross-shard communication failures.

Future Innovations and Trends

As we look to the future, several innovations and trends are poised to further enhance the scalability of parallel execution in smart contracts. Quantum-resistant cryptographic algorithms, advanced machine learning models for predictive analytics, and new consensus mechanisms like Byzantine Fault Tolerance (BFT) are some of the promising developments.

Quantum Computing and Blockchain

The advent of quantum computing introduces both challenges and opportunities for blockchain scalability. While quantum computers pose a threat to current cryptographic systems, they also offer the potential for unprecedented computational power. Integrating quantum-resistant algorithms into parallel execution frameworks will be crucial to maintaining security in the quantum era.

Machine Learning and Predictive Analytics

Machine learning models can play a significant role in optimizing parallel execution. Predictive analytics can help in load balancing, predicting transaction patterns, and optimizing resource allocation. By leveraging these advanced techniques, blockchain networks can achieve more efficient and scalable parallel execution.

Conclusion

Parallel execution in smart contracts stands as a beacon of innovation in the blockchain space, paving the way for scalability to reach the ambitious target of 100k TPS. By breaking down complex transactions into parallel processes and leveraging advanced computational techniques, this technology unlocks new possibilities for decentralized applications, DeFi platforms, supply chain management, DAOs, gaming, and more. As we continue to navigate this exciting frontier, the integration of cutting-edge innovations will ensure that the blockchain ecosystem evolves to meet the demands of the future. The journey towards scalability is not just a technical challenge—it's a transformative opportunity to redefine the boundaries of decentralized technology.

The hum of servers, the flicker of screens, the almost imperceptible buzz of data streams – this is the soundtrack of our modern economy. We are living through a paradigm shift, a revolution where value is no longer solely tethered to tangible goods and physical locations. Instead, a new frontier of wealth is being forged in the ethereal realm of digital assets. This isn't science fiction; it's the very present, and for those who understand its nuances, it's a pathway to "Digital Assets, Real Profits."

For generations, wealth was measured in acres of land, ounces of gold, or the bricks and mortar of a business. While these still hold value, a significant portion of the world's burgeoning wealth now resides in bytes and code. Digital assets represent ownership or rights to value, existing purely in a digital format. Think of them as the evolution of traditional assets, reimagined for the internet age. This encompasses a vast and ever-expanding spectrum.

The most prominent and perhaps the most talked-about category is cryptocurrencies. Bitcoin, Ethereum, and thousands of altcoins are more than just digital currencies; they are programmable assets built on the revolutionary technology of blockchain. Blockchain, in essence, is a decentralized, distributed ledger that records transactions across many computers. This makes cryptocurrencies secure, transparent, and resistant to censorship or single points of failure. The profit potential here is widely recognized, stemming from their inherent volatility, potential for adoption as a medium of exchange, and their role within the burgeoning decentralized finance (DeFi) ecosystem. Investing in cryptocurrencies requires a keen understanding of market dynamics, technological developments, and macroeconomic trends. It's a space where fortunes can be made and lost rapidly, demanding a calculated approach, robust risk management, and often, a long-term vision.

Beyond currencies, we have Non-Fungible Tokens (NFTs). If cryptocurrencies are like digital dollars, fungible and interchangeable, NFTs are unique digital items. Each NFT has a distinct identifier and metadata that distinguishes it from any other. This uniqueness allows them to represent ownership of digital art, music, collectibles, virtual real estate in metaverses, and even unique in-game items. The value of an NFT is driven by a complex interplay of factors, including the creator's reputation, the rarity of the item, its historical significance (within the digital realm), and the community surrounding it. For artists and creators, NFTs offer a revolutionary way to monetize their digital work directly, cutting out intermediaries and retaining a larger share of the profits, often with built-in royalties for future sales. For collectors and investors, NFTs represent a new avenue for acquiring unique digital assets, potentially appreciating in value over time due to scarcity and cultural relevance. The market for NFTs has experienced explosive growth, though it, too, is subject to speculation and requires careful discernment.

The concept of tokenization is another game-changer, blurring the lines between digital and traditional assets. Tokenization involves representing a real-world asset – like a piece of real estate, a work of art, or even a company's shares – as a digital token on a blockchain. This process democratizes investment opportunities that were previously out of reach for many. Imagine being able to buy a fraction of a luxury apartment in a prime location or a portion of a renowned painting, all through easily tradable digital tokens. This not only increases liquidity for traditionally illiquid assets but also lowers the barrier to entry for investors. The profits here are derived from the appreciation of the underlying asset, potentially enhanced by the increased accessibility and tradability offered by tokenization. This is a fundamental shift that could redefine ownership and investment across numerous industries.

The metaverse, a persistent, interconnected set of virtual worlds, is rapidly becoming a fertile ground for digital assets. Virtual land, avatar accessories, and digital experiences within these metaverses are all forms of digital assets that can be bought, sold, and traded. As these virtual worlds gain traction and user bases grow, the value of these digital possessions is expected to increase. Owning virtual real estate in a popular metaverse might offer potential for rental income, advertising revenue, or simply resale at a profit as the metaverse expands. The creativity and innovation in this space are boundless, offering new forms of engagement and economic activity that are entirely digital.

Furthermore, digital collectibles, from rare in-game items to unique digital trading cards, have carved out their own profitable niches. Platforms like NBA Top Shot, which sells officially licensed digital basketball highlights as NFTs, have demonstrated the appeal of owning unique moments and assets in a digital format. The profit potential lies in the inherent scarcity and the passionate communities that form around these collectibles, driving demand and value.

Navigating this evolving landscape requires a strategic mindset. It's not simply about chasing the latest trend; it's about understanding the underlying technology, the market dynamics, and the potential for long-term value creation. Education is paramount. Understanding blockchain technology, the specific use cases of different digital assets, and the risks involved is the first step towards unlocking real profits from these digital endeavors. Diversification, a cornerstone of sound investment, also applies here. Spreading investments across different types of digital assets can help mitigate risk and capture a broader range of opportunities.

The journey into digital assets is an exciting one, promising new avenues for wealth generation and financial empowerment. It's a realm where innovation is constant, and the definition of value is continually being rewritten. As we delve deeper, we'll explore the strategies and considerations that can help you navigate this dynamic space and truly unlock the potential of "Digital Assets, Real Profits."

Having laid the groundwork for the diverse world of digital assets, let's now pivot to the practicalities of generating "Digital Assets, Real Profits." This isn't about speculative gambles, but rather a thoughtful approach to acquiring, managing, and ultimately profiting from these innovative forms of value. The landscape is dynamic, and success hinges on a combination of informed strategy, diligent execution, and an adaptable mindset.

One of the foundational strategies for profit in the digital asset space, particularly with cryptocurrencies, is long-term holding (HODLing). This strategy, born out of the early days of Bitcoin, involves purchasing an asset and holding onto it for an extended period, regardless of short-term market fluctuations. The belief is that the underlying technology and its adoption will lead to significant price appreciation over time. This approach requires immense patience and a conviction in the long-term vision of the project or asset. It's less about active trading and more about strategic accumulation and weathering market volatility. The profit materializes when the asset's value significantly outstrips the purchase price, often years down the line. However, it's crucial to conduct thorough research into the fundamental value and potential of the cryptocurrency before committing to a long-term hold.

For those with a more active disposition, trading presents another avenue for profit. This involves buying and selling digital assets more frequently, aiming to capitalize on price swings. This can range from day trading, where positions are closed within a single day, to swing trading, which aims to capture profits from market "swings" over a few days or weeks. Successful trading demands a deep understanding of technical analysis (chart patterns, indicators), market sentiment, and the ability to react swiftly to news and events. It's a high-stakes game that requires discipline, emotional control, and robust risk management. Setting stop-loss orders to limit potential losses and taking profits strategically are essential practices to ensure that trading efforts translate into real profits rather than substantial deficits. The learning curve for effective trading can be steep, and continuous education is key.

The realm of yield farming and liquidity providing within Decentralized Finance (DeFi) offers passive income opportunities from digital assets. DeFi protocols allow users to lend, borrow, and trade digital assets without traditional financial intermediaries. By providing liquidity to these decentralized exchanges or lending platforms, users earn rewards in the form of transaction fees or newly minted tokens. Yield farming involves strategically moving assets between different DeFi protocols to maximize returns, often referred to as "APY" (Annual Percentage Yield). While this can generate significant passive income, it also carries its own set of risks, including smart contract vulnerabilities, impermanent loss (a risk specific to liquidity provision), and the inherent volatility of the underlying assets. Understanding the mechanics of each DeFi protocol and the associated risks is paramount before participating.

For NFTs, profit generation can stem from several angles. Acquisition and resale is the most direct. This involves identifying NFTs that are undervalued or have strong potential for future appreciation, purchasing them, and then selling them at a higher price. This requires an eye for emerging artists, understanding of community sentiment, and an awareness of market trends within specific NFT categories (e.g., art, gaming, collectibles). Creating and selling original NFTs is another significant profit driver, particularly for artists and content creators. By minting their digital creations as NFTs, they can directly monetize their work and, through smart contract programming, even earn royalties on secondary sales, creating a recurring revenue stream. Utility-driven NFTs, which offer holders specific benefits like access to exclusive communities, in-game advantages, or real-world perks, can also command premium prices and provide ongoing value.

Tokenized real estate offers a unique blend of traditional investment with digital asset accessibility. Profit can be realized through appreciation of the underlying property's value, much like traditional real estate investment. However, tokenization adds the benefit of liquidity. Investors can buy and sell fractional ownership tokens more easily than trading physical property, potentially leading to quicker capital gains. Furthermore, token holders might also receive rental income distributions, paid out in cryptocurrency or stablecoins, providing a passive income stream. The regulatory landscape for tokenized real estate is still evolving, and due diligence on the issuing platform and the underlying property is critical.

The concept of digital asset management and portfolio diversification is as crucial in the digital realm as it is in traditional finance. Instead of focusing on a single digital asset, building a diversified portfolio across different categories – cryptocurrencies, NFTs, tokenized assets, and potentially metaverse-related assets – can mitigate risk. This means understanding the correlation between different asset classes and allocating capital accordingly. A well-managed portfolio requires regular rebalancing, staying informed about market developments, and adjusting strategies based on evolving economic conditions and technological advancements.

Risk management cannot be overstated. The digital asset space is characterized by its volatility and the presence of novel risks. This includes the risk of cyberattacks and hacks, the potential for regulatory changes that could impact asset values, and the inherent speculative nature of many digital assets. Implementing security best practices, such as using hardware wallets for cryptocurrency storage, enabling two-factor authentication, and being wary of phishing scams, is non-negotiable. Understanding the "burn" rate of new projects, the strength of their development teams, and the real-world problems they aim to solve are crucial for assessing long-term viability.

Finally, continuous learning and adaptation are the ultimate keys to sustained profitability. The digital asset ecosystem is an innovation frontier. New technologies, platforms, and asset classes emerge with astonishing speed. Staying informed through reputable sources, engaging with communities, and being open to learning about new opportunities and evolving risks is not just advisable; it's essential. The digital revolution is ongoing, and those who are willing to learn, adapt, and strategically engage with "Digital Assets, Real Profits" are poised to thrive in this exciting new era of wealth creation.

Fueling the Future_ Your Comprehensive Guide to the 1000x EVM Developer Migration

2026 Strategies for DAO Governance and Quantum Resistant with Bitcoin USDT_ The Future of Decentrali

Advertisement
Advertisement